Health Inspection Findings & Deficiencies
SILVER RIDGE HEALTHCARE CENTER had 7 health inspection deficiencies on its most recent inspection (April 11, 2025), including 1 classified as severe.
Inspection Findings — April 11, 2025
-
Honor the resident's right to and the facility must promote and facilitate resident self-determination through support of resident choice. (Level D)Corrected — April 24, 2025
-
Provide appropriate treatment and care according to orders, resident’s preferences and goals. (Level D)Corrected — April 24, 2025
-
Provide appropriate pressure ulcer care and prevent new ulcers from developing. (Level D)Corrected — April 24, 2025
-
Ensure that feeding tubes are not used unless there is a medical reason and the resident agrees; and provide appropriate care for a resident with a feeding tube. (Level D)Corrected — April 24, 2025
-
Ensure drugs and biologicals used in the facility are labeled in accordance with currently accepted professional principles; and all drugs and biologicals must be stored in locked compartments, separately locked, compartments for controlled drugs. (Level D)Corrected — April 24, 2025
-
Procure food from sources approved or considered satisfactory and store, prepare, distribute and serve food in accordance with professional standards. (Level K)Corrected — May 22, 2025
-
Ensure nurse aides have the skills they need to care for residents, and give nurse aides education in dementia care and abuse prevention. (Level D)Corrected — April 24, 2025
Silver Ridge Healthcare Center is a 148-bed nursing home in Las Vegas, Nevada. It holds a 1-star CMS overall rating. Total nurse staffing is 3.6 hours per resident day, below the Nevada average of 4.4. Its most recent inspection, in April 2025, cited 7 deficiencies, one of them severe. It is on CMS's Special Focus Facility list, a designation for persistently poor-performing nursing homes.
This facility’s Special Focus status and recent inspection problems point to serious, ongoing concerns about resident protection, care planning, and staffing.
